The Hornets Nest

The plan started by drawing a tragic battle against an invisible force. It is the enemy mission that appears through the complex terrain of the country, as no soldier has ever gone before. Two journalists, a father and son, started a new experience by recording everything the troops are doing across the cruel and bloody battlefields
